Sellerboard is as close as you’ll get to an all-in-one Amazon FBA inventory management tool. It’s packed with features, has a clean and intuitive interface, and offers some of the most accurate inventory forecasting available. Plus, it’s the most affordable option on our list, starting at just $19/month.
The Inventory Planner is the heart of Sellerboard’s system. It gives you a snapshot of your inventory health, displaying key metrics like FBA and FBM stock, prep stock, ordered units, and total inventory. You’ll also get a breakdown of your individual products. Each product shows critical info like stock value, sales velocity, days of stock left, and days until the next order. The display is conveniently color-coded, and clicking on each metric brings up more details along with a graph to help you visualize the data more easily.
By taking the time to upload your lead times, supplier info, and product information Sellerboard can create organized reorder suggestions to help you avoid inventory fees. There are options to account for seasonality, adjust for prep centers, or add buffer days for more safety. Overall the software is incredibly easy to use and very flexible for all types of sellers.
Besides the Inventory Planner, Sellerboard also has tabs to manage and create purchase orders, track FBA shipments, and manage your suppliers. And if you’re managing a large catalog, you’ll love the bulk data upload feature, which supports .xls, .csv, and Google Sheets.
Sellerboard isn’t just about inventory management, though. It also offers tools for analytics, PPC tracking, and even an FBA reimbursement tool to deal with damaged or lost inventory. With its robust features, user-friendly design, and unbeatable price, it’s no wonder it’s our top pick for the best overall Amazon FBA inventory software.

With millions of users and over 20 high-quality tools available, Helium 10 remains one of the most popular Amazon seller platforms available. With solutions for keyword analysis, product research, analytics, listing optimization, and inventory management it remains a great choice for sellers searching for an all-in-one solution.
At the core of its inventory management is the Restock Suggestions page. This clean, user-friendly dashboard displays your products with key metrics like days of supply, reorder status, recommended reorder units, and reorder cost. There is also optional information for inventory stored in your own warehouse or a third-party facility. Clicking on a product reveals a detailed graph of historical sales and projected future sales, helping you make smarter restocking decisions.
The tool also includes a Suppliers Page to organize supplier information, a Local Warehouse feature for tracking non-FBA inventory, and a Purchase Orders tool for creating and sending PDF orders to suppliers. Need to track inbound FBA shipments? Helium 10’s Inbound FBA Shipments page gives you real-time updates on shipment statuses, including Amazon’s status, supplier details, and units outstanding.

If you’re a retail or online arbitrage seller, there’s a good chance you’ve heard of InventoryLab. It’s a favorite among arbitrage sellers and even used by many large prep centers, thanks to its robust features for sourcing, organizing, and shipping products to Amazon. While its price has been creeping up year after year, its unique tool set makes it worth the investment for many sellers.
InventoryLab shines when it comes to creating FBA shipments. You can create and organize shipments from directly within the software as well as print the necessary labels for your packages. It is much easier than working through Seller Central and is the number one reason that sellers choose InventoryLab.
Besides shipments, you can also create listings directly through InventoryLab, source new products to sell, and access a variety of ready-made reports to monitor your business. The Inventory Page gives you a clear overview of your FBA, MFN (Merchant Fulfilled Network), and unlisted inventory, which are items you are either storing at home or in a third-party storage center.
For retail arbitrage sellers, the Scoutify app is also included with your subscription. This tool lets you scan products in stores to check profitability on the spot. (if you are familiar with SellerAmp it is quite similar) The app has alerts to notify you if you’re gated from selling certain products, if a product is hazmat, or if it has an expiration date. Plus, the Storage Fee Estimator helps you calculate potential storage fees, so you can avoid surprises down the line.

If you’re looking for a dedicated Amazon inventory software you can’t go wrong with RestockPro. While it doesn’t have the range of tools that some of its competitors offer, it makes up for it with quality and depth. The platform is full of helpful features that will take your inventory game to the next level.
RestockPro’s Dashboard is a powerhouse, displaying widgets with key metrics like total inventory value, reorder alerts, restock alerts, and a list of your top-selling products. You’ll also see a breakdown of active SKUs, inventory on order, and FBA shipments in transit.
The Restock Suggestions Page is where RestockPro truly shines. It provides detailed data for every SKU, including sales velocity, total orders, reorder suggestions, and a full breakdown of Amazon fees for accurate margin calculations. Color-coded flags make it easy to spot urgent restocks (red), upcoming restocks (yellow), out-of-stock items (purple), and new products (blue).
For sellers who create bundles or kits, RestockPro includes a Kits feature to streamline the process. And if you’re managing shipments, the POs and Shipments section lets you track statuses, create purchase orders, and email them directly to suppliers. It’s a seamless way to keep your supply chain running smoothly.

For larger Amazon sellers looking for a premium solution, SoStocked is the ultimate inventory management tool. It’s packed with advanced features, has an exceptional user interface, and offers unparalleled customization. But with great power comes a higher price tag. SoStocked is the most expensive tool on our list, making it best suited for established sellers who can justify the investment.
At the heart of SoStocked is its Forecast Page, which uses multiple methods to calculate sales velocity, including 30, 60, 90, and 180-day averages. It also accounts for sales spikes and stockouts to provide more accurate projections than its competitors. It also includes seasonal spike charts, so you can quickly identify historical sales patterns and plan for future campaigns.
The UI is very easy to navigate and includes search bars, filters, and custom tags to easily find specific SKUs. It also includes features not present in other tools, like the Lightning Deals feature that lets you calculate reorder decisions based on upcoming sales like Prime Day, Black Friday, or your own custom email campaign.
For forecasting SoStocked lets you set detailed lead times (production, ocean freight, land freight, etc) and customize stock levels for both FBA and third-party warehouse inventory. It also gives you the option to automatically generate purchase orders based on its restock suggestions which you can email directly to suppliers.
To organize and track shipments, SoStocked includes an orders tab that allows you to track shipments through every phase, from production and transit to FBA check-in. Shipments automatically move through each phase based on your custom lead times, but you can also manually update them if delays occur. The interface is clean and highly customizable, with filterable columns and metrics to suit your needs.

If you’re selling on multiple platforms like Amazon, Walmart, eBay, or Etsy, Sellbrite is the tool you need to keep everything organized. Unlike other tools on this list, Sellbrite isn’t just for Amazon, it’s designed to centralize inventory management for multi-channel sellers. With its affordable pricing and seamless integrations, it’s a standout choice for sellers who want to streamline their operations across multiple platforms.
Sellbrite’s Dashboard is clean and intuitive, featuring widgets for total sales, total orders, recent activity, top-selling products, and more. You can create and update listings directly within Sellbrite, adjust prices across platforms in one click, and automatically sync inventory every 10-15 minutes to avoid overselling. If you need to make quick adjustments, you can also manually update quantities.
One of Sellbrite’s best features is its ability to sync FBA inventory with other sales channels. This means you can use your FBA stock to fulfill orders from Walmart, eBay, or Etsy, saving you time and hassle. The platform also integrates with ShipStation and USPS, allowing you to create invoices, packing slips, pick lists, and USPS scan forms, all from one place.
